What’s Happening
Work will be limited over the holiday and will resume on January 2, 2019. Crews will continue pavement repair and roadway maintenance, and address issues as needed. Upcoming construction activities include:
• Constructing bridge abutments at the Route 28 and I-495 interchanges
• Constructing box culverts inside the Route 123 Interchange for shared-use path
• Constructing retaining walls near Jermantown Road
• Grading, excavating, and clearing trees and brush at the Route 28, Route 123, Route 50, and I-495 interchanges and other work zone locations along the corridor
• Grading, excavating, and small charge blasting for storm drain trenches at the future University Boulevard Park and Ride Lot
• Grading and excavating for the new E.C. Lawrence Park Access Road
• Relocating underground and overhead utilities along I-66 and Route 28

The Transform 66 Outside the Beltway project will add express lanes stretching 22.5 miles from the Capital Beltway to Route 29 in Gainesville, rebuild major interchanges along the I-66 corridor, create thousands of new park and ride spaces, and expand trail options for cyclists and pedestrians.
